Guys if this was your project what would you start with first ?? Here are my Plans for the truck again. Mopar 318 with a four barrel Carb & Auto tranny (Still need to find a Motor and Trans) Have front Axle stretched (4" drop") disc brake conversion up front, with Power brakes. Modern rear Axle, mounted on top of the Leafs. C-Notch the Frame. Rust repair/Patch Panels for anything larger than a Golf Ball. Reinforce/rework front Cab Body Mounts. (Some rot in the Driver side in Particular.) Update wiring system. Clear coat original paint. Here are pics of the mounts Is it possible to find this driver side floor board Panel ? Anyone have one for sale ? Thanks for all your support thus far ! Justin
